BLUE SPRINGS, Mo. – The Augustana women's golf team opened 2024-25 with a victory in a 17-team field concluding Wednesday. The Vikings, competing at the Central Region Fall Preview on Tuesday and Wednesday, shot past 16 other schools to claim the victory in Blue Springs, Missouri.
Shannon McCormick and
Lanie Veenendall finished in a tie for fourth with 146 strokes.
Inside the Tournament
Tournament Finish: 1st / 17
Tournament Champion: Augustana University / 592 (+16)
Location: Blue Springs, Missouri / Adams Pointe
How it Happened
- McCormick finished day one of the tournament with a score of 2-under-par and recorded five birdies on the day. She had a stretch of three holes with back-to-back-to-back birdies. On day two, she tallied two birdies for a final stroke count of 146.
- Veenendall posted a score of 1-over-par after day one with a birdie. She controlled the course on day two with three birdies.
- Anna Eckmann made her collegiate debut on Tuesday and shot 1-over-par. She finished day one with an eagle on hole 18. She followed up day two with a birdie on hole 14 and finished the tournament in a share for 10th with a stroke count of 148.
- Payton Drefke finished the tournament with a stroke count of 153 and a tie for 30th in her first outing as a Viking. She recorded three birdies on day two.
- Masy Mock finished in a tie for 39th after rounds of 80 and 75 for a total stroke count of 155. She recorded two birdies on day two.
